چکیده مقاله:

Background and Aim : Olibanum as a resin of Boswellia serrata (B. serrata) from Burseracea family has been proposed as an effective anti-inflammatory and antioxidant agent. We are suggested that this resin can attenuate the generation of oxidant agents and reinforce the anti-oxidant agents to improve memory impairment induced by scopolamine.Methods : Forty male Wistar rats were divided into four groups (n=10 each group): Control (diluted DMSO + saline), Scopolamine (diluted DMSO + 1mg/kg Scopolamine), Scopolamine- Oliban 100 and Scopolamine- Oliban 200 (Olibanum 100 mg/kg or 200 mg/ kg before Scopolamine). Learning and memory performance and biochemistry data were evaluated in all groups.Results : Scopolamine administration increased the duration and distance to find the platform in the Morris water maze(MWM) test in compare to control group in 5 days (P<0.05 to P<0.001) while, scopolamine decreesed the latency to enter to the dark compartment after receiving the sock in passive avoidance (PA) test (P<0.001). Pretreatment with both doses of Olibanum enhanced performances of the rats in MWM (P<0.05 to P<0.01) and PA test (P<0.01 to P<0.001). scopolamine also increased hippocampal MDA levels (P<0.001) while, decreased CAT, SOD and thiol (P<0.001). Olibanum increased hippocampal CAT, SOD and thiols (P<0.01 to P<0.001).Conclusion : Olibanum showed an anti-inflammatory and antioxidant properties. It could improve memory impairment induced by scopolamine.
